The most common reasons a Audi Q5 Sportback engine is stalling are the fuel system, the air intake system, or the ignition system.
  • Fuel System: A clogged fuel filter or failing fuel pump can restrict fuel flow, resulting in poor engine performance and starting issues.
  • Air Intake System: A dirty or damaged air filter or a malfunctioning mass airflow sensor can restrict airflow, leading to reduced engine performance and efficiency.

A faulty oxygen sensor is one of the most common causes of a check engine light. Symptoms may include a decrease in fuel mileage, hesitation or misfiring from the engine, rough idling or even stalling. A faulty sensor may cause the vehicle to fail an emissions test.

Any time there is an emissions fault the check engine light will be displayed. The purpose of the check engine light is to inform the driver that an emission related fault has been found, and that there are on-board diagnostic (OBD) trouble codes stored in the powertrain or engine control module. Additionally, since the emissions systems are so intertwined into engine control and transmission control systems, symptoms may include nearly any sort of drivability concerns. This may include harsh shifting, failure to shift, hesitation on acceleration, jerking, engine failure to start or run, loss of power, or any number of other drivability issues.

The most likely symptom of a faulty fuel temperature sensor is a check engine light. When the sensor goes bad, the Engine Control Module signals the driver that there is a problem by turning on the dash light. Poor fuel economy might also be noticed. In some cases, a failing fuel temperature sensor could lead to hard starting of the engine or an engine misfire and poor performance.

When the Check Engine Light comes on, you may experience engine performance issues such as poor acceleration, rough idling, or an engine that won't start. In some cases, no abnormal symptoms will be experienced. Other systems like the transmission or ABS can cause the Check Engine Light to illuminate and lights for those systems can come on at the same time. Similar lights may say "Check Engine Soon", "Malfunction Indicator Light" or just "Check". In rare case the engine can overheat.

Troubleshooting Engine Stalling Issues in an Audi Q5 Sportback

When addressing engine stalling issues in your Audi Q5 Sportback, begin by observing the symptoms closely. Pay attention to any rough idling, sudden power loss, or hesitation during acceleration, as these can provide critical clues. If the check engine light is illuminated, it’s a clear indication that the vehicle’s onboard diagnostics have detected a fault, often related to the fuel or air intake systems. Start your troubleshooting by checking the fuel system; ensure that you are using high-quality fuel and that there are no blockages or leaks in the fuel lines. Next, inspect the air intake system for any obstructions or issues that could affect airflow. If these initial checks do not resolve the problem, consider examining the ignition system, including spark plugs and ignition coils, as they can also contribute to stalling. Regular maintenance is key; adhering to service intervals and promptly addressing any emerging symptoms can significantly reduce the likelihood of stalling issues. What Are the Common Causes of Engine Stalling in an Audi Q5 Sportback?

When diagnosing engine stalling in an Audi Q5 Sportback, it's essential to consider several common problems that could be affecting performance. One of the primary areas to investigate is the fuel system, as issues such as a malfunctioning fuel pump or clogged fuel injectors can prevent the engine from receiving adequate fuel, particularly during acceleration or under heavy load. Additionally, the air intake system plays a crucial role; a faulty Mass Air Flow (MAF) sensor can disrupt the air-fuel mixture, leading to stalling and triggering warning lights on the dashboard. Electrical issues, including a weak battery or moisture in the fuel, can also contribute to engine stalling, making it vital to check these components. Furthermore, if the engine timing is off, it can result in misfires and stalling, indicating a need for timing adjustments. Lastly, excessive oil consumption due to worn piston rings or valve seals can lead to broader engine problems, so monitoring oil levels and consumption is advisable.
